AGENDA TITLE: Public Hearing to Consider Introducing an Ordinance Amending Lodi
Municipal Code Chapter 13.20 — Electrical Service — by Repealing and
Reenacting Section 13.20.315, "Schedule EDR — Economic
Development Rate" - In Its Entirety
MEETING DATE: March 20, 2013
PREPARED BY: Electric Utility Director
RECOMMENDED ACTION: Public hearing to consider introducing an ordinance amending Lodi
Municipal Code Chapter 13.20 — Electrical Service — by repealing and
reenacting Section 13.20.315, "Schedule EDR — Economic
Development Rate - in its entirety.
BACKGROUND INFORMATION: For the past 18 months, the City of Lodi has offered a pair of electric
rate discounts: New Business and New Jobs. Year-to-date, 22
customers have signed up to receive one of the two rate discounts.
As of February 1, 2013, this has resulted in a total savings of approximately $346,000 for the participating
businesses.
Both of these rate discounts expire on June 30, 2013. Staff is recommending that both rate discounts,
which serve as excellent economic development tools for the City of Lodi, be extended from July 1, 2013
to June 30, 2015 under the following guidelines:
New Business Rate Discount: provided for 12 consecutive months; all new businesses assigned to the
G2, G3, G4, G5, or 11 electric rate will receive a 5% discount per month; all new businesses assigned to
the G1 electric rate will receive a "flat monthly credit" of $25 per month.
New Jobs Rate Discount: provided for 12 consecutive months; all new hires must be new, full-time
positions; there is a maximum 8% rate discount available, and the discount is provided in "bands" as
shown below:
Number of New, Full -Time Employees
Percentage Discount
1-3
2%
4-6
4%
7-9
6%
10+
8%
FISCAL IMPACT: From July 1, 2011 to February 1, 2013, the discounts have totaled $346,000. It is
anticipated that the total discount will exceed $400,000 by June 30, 2013. The
magnitude of the financial impact for the proposed July 2013 to June 2015 rate
discounts will be dependent upon the total number of participants.

BE IT ORDAINED BY THE LODI CITY COUNCIL AS FOLLOWS:
SECTION 1. Lodi Municipal Code Section 13.20.315, "Schedule EDR — Economic
Development Rate," is hereby repealed and reenacted in its entirety to read as follows:
APPLICABILITY:
A. New Business Rate Discount. NBR discount, applicable to any new commercial or
industrial customer that locates their operations/business that receives electric utility
service from the City of Lodi, with the following stipulations: a customer assigned to
the G1 electric utility rate shall receive a discount for twelve consecutive months of
$25 per month; and, customers assigned to the G2, G3, G4, G5, or 11 electric utility
rate shall receive a discount for twelve consecutive months of five percent; and this
rate discount may not be combined with any other electric discount or rate and shall
only apply to the base rate. Surcharges including, but not limited to, the California
Energy Commission fee, solar surcharge, public benefits charge, state energy tax,
and other assessments or charges after the date of this rate schedule shall not be
subject to this discount.
B. New Jobs Rate Discount. NJR discount, applicable to any commercial or industrial
customer that adds a minimum of one full-time position, and retains that position for
at least twelve consecutive months, with the following stipulation: a two percent
discount for one to three new positions; four percent for four to six new positions; six
percent for seven to nine positions; and eight percent for ten or more new positions.
The maximum discount available is eight percent; all discounts are available for
twelve consecutive months; and this rate discount may not be combined with any
other electric discount or rate and shall only apply to the base rate. Surcharges
including, but not limited to, the California Energy Commission fee, solar surcharge,
public benefits charge, state energy tax, and other assessments or charges after the
date of this rate schedule shall not be subject to this discount.
C. The Rate Schedules referenced above shall be effective on applicable electric utility
billings prepared by the City of Lodi on or after July 1, 2013 and said utility rate
discounts shall expire on June 30, 2015.

Existing Rates
o New Business Rate Discount
• 5% to 15%
• Varies by customer class
o New Jobs Rate Discount
• 1 %per hire (minimum 2 FTEs)
• Capped at 15%
o Twelve consecutive months
o Sunsets 6/30/13
Current Participation
o Economic development tool since 2011
o New Business Rate Discount ~ 13 customers
o New Jobs Rate Discount ~ 9 customers
o $346,000 as of 2/1/13
